The MDPN<http://mipres.org/> is a membership-based organization dedicated to providing digital preservation services to cultural memory institutions, research organizations, and others that maintain electronic records or digital collections. The MDPN welcomes organizations of all sizes, technical capacity, and financial ability across Michigan. By concentrating resources and knowledge towards a single effort, the MDPN seeks to reduce redundant efforts in the state and build capacity for more organizations to participate. The MDPN was created by a 2019 Memorandum of Understanding between the Library of Michigan, Grand Valley State University, Michigan State University, the Midwest Collaborative for Library Services, and Western Michigan University. Current members include Capital Area District Libraries, Eastern Michigan University, Grand Valley State University, Hillsdale College, Michigan State University, the University of Michigan, Wayne State University, and Western Michigan University.

The MDPN was recently awarded a National Leadership Grant for Libraries<https://imls.gov/grants/awarded/lg-252394-ols-22> from the Institute for Museum and Library Services to demonstrate a statewide model for affordable and easy-to-use digital preservation services using free and open source tools, including Academic Preservation Trust’s DART<https://aptrust.github.io/dart-docs/> application and LOCKSS 2.0/LAAWS<https://www.lockss.org/about/frequently-asked-questions#laaws> (LOCKSS Architected as a Web Service). This award provides funding for hardware purchases related to node hosting for at least five geographically distributed hosts.
